Description of problem: ----------------------- Attempt to 'cancel' overcloud update reports error when operator requests to cancel update: openstack overcloud update stack -i overcloud Started Mistral Workflow tripleo.package_update.v1.package_update_plan. Execution ID: 433009fe-2c10-4241-8f48-a9c6c46a9f38 Waiting for messages on queue 'dd8e32d7-0216-465c-9210-86cbca6c8513' with no timeout. WAITING not_started: [u'ceph-2'] on_breakpoint: [u'compute-0', u'controller-2', u'ceph-0', u'controller-0', u'ceph-1', u'controller-1'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 60595c23-63e8-47d3-91d7-6e2b40f8f322), no=cancel update, C-c=quit interactive mode: IN_PROGRESS WAITING completed: [u'controller-1'] on_breakpoint: [u'ceph-2', u'compute-0', u'ceph-0', u'controller-0', u'ceph-1', u'controller-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 3211202f-0582-40e4-a242-3ded79ba2be6), no=cancel update, C-c=quit interactive mode: IN_PROGRESS WAITING completed: [u'controller-2', u'controller-1'] on_breakpoint: [u'compute-0', u'ceph-1', u'controller-0', u'ceph-2', u'ceph-0'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 9cc1f1f1-74a6-48dd-bc9f-4717e0287219), no=cancel update, C-c=quit interactive mode: IN_PROGRESS WAITING completed: [u'controller-2', u'controller-1', u'ceph-0'] on_breakpoint: [u'ceph-1', u'controller-0', u'ceph-2', u'compute-0'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ear e2176598-d109-4e5a-aea3-afa7c8ef3e5a), no=cancel update, C-c=quit interactive mode: WAITING completed: [u'controller-2', u'compute-0', u'controller-1', u'ceph-0'] on_breakpoint: [u'ceph-1', u'controller-0', u'ceph-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 21a484f6-f906-4876-b946-1010ead62325), no=cancel update, C-c=quit interactive mode: cancel WAITING completed: [u'controller-2', u'compute-0', u'controller-1', u'ceph-0'] on_breakpoint: [u'ceph-1', u'controller-0', u'ceph-2'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 21a484f6-f906-4876-b946-1010ead62325), no=cancel update, C-c=quit interactive mode: no canceling update, doing rollback WAITING on_breakpoint: [u'ceph-2', u'compute-0', u'controller-2', u'ceph-0', u'controller-0', u'ceph-1', u'controller-1'] Breakpoint reached, continue? Regexp or Enter=proceed (will clear 60595c23-63e8-47d3-91d7-6e2b40f8f322), no=cancel update, C-c=quit interactive mode: no canceling update, doing rollback ERROR: Cancelling update when stack is ROLLBACK_IN_PROGRESS is not supported. openstack stack list +--------------------------------------+------------+----------------------+----------------------+----------------------+ | ID | Stack Name | Stack Status | Creation Time | Updated Time | +--------------------------------------+------------+----------------------+----------------------+----------------------+ | 1ca3a4ca-ff75-497c-8fea-2caa097969a6 | overcloud | ROLLBACK_IN_PROGRESS | 2017-03-01T11:54:17Z | 2017-03-06T06:45:02Z | +--------------------------------------+------------+----------------------+----------------------+----------------------+ Version-Release number of selected component (if applicable): ------------------------------------------------------------- openstack-tripleo-heat-templates-6.0.0-0.20170222195630.46117f4.el7ost.noarch openstack-tripleo-validations-5.4.0-0.20170217125407.6b928f1.el7ost.noarch openstack-tripleo-puppet-elements-6.0.0-0.20170217130711.3e6bc8c.el7ost.noarch puppet-tripleo-6.2.0-0.20170222195517.7f91deb.el7ost.noarch openstack-tripleo-image-elements-6.0.0-0.20170217063119.ad33b59.el7ost.noarch python-tripleoclient-6.0.1-0.20170220144855.b3c0e3e.el7ost.noarch openstack-tripleo-ui-3.0.1-0.20170224170804.8f3b43e.el7ost.noarch openstack-tripleo-common-5.8.1-0.20170220145134.8ff75ce.el7ost.noarch openstack-mistral-common-4.0.1-0.20170222161147.060a153.el7ost.noarch python-openstack-mistral-4.0.1-0.20170222161147.060a153.el7ost.noarch openstack-mistral-engine-4.0.1-0.20170222161147.060a153.el7ost.noarch puppet-mistral-10.3.0-0.20170213130808.a6e8ebc.el7ost.noarch openstack-mistral-executor-4.0.1-0.20170222161147.060a153.el7ost.noarch python-mistralclient-3.0.0-0.20170208192040.a7bf138.el7ost.noarch openstack-mistral-api-4.0.1-0.20170222161147.060a153.el7ost.noarch python-heatclient-1.8.0-0.20170208192329.17dd306.el7ost.noarch openstack-heat-api-8.0.0-0.20170222153633.2dd8335.el7ost.noarch openstack-heat-api-cfn-8.0.0-0.20170222153633.2dd8335.el7ost.noarch puppet-heat-10.3.0-0.20170210225040.920f4f9.el7ost.noarch heat-cfntools-1.3.0-2.el7ost.noarch python-heat-agent-1.0.0-1.el7ost.noarch openstack-heat-engine-8.0.0-0.20170222153633.2dd8335.el7ost.noarch openstack-heat-common-8.0.0-0.20170222153633.2dd8335.el7ost.noarch Steps to Reproduce: ------------------- 1. Deploy RHOS-11 2. Setup latest repos on undercloud and overcloud 3. Update undercloud 4. Start overcloud update 5. After few nodes are updated request update to cancel Expected results: ----------------- Operator is not allowed/asked to cancel update after 'cancel' operation being already requested. Additional info: ---------------- Virtual setup. Re-run of update operation after failed attemp.
Closing as a duplicate to 1434712. Keeping 1434712 as the primary as it already has existing history and progress. *** This bug has been marked as a duplicate of bug 1434712 ***